BER Performance of Frequency Domain Differential Demodulation OFDM in Flat Fading Channel
作者姓名:SONG  Lijun  TANG  Youxi  LI  Shaoqian  HUANG  Shunji
作者单位:National Key Laboratory of Communication,UESTC Chengdu 610054 China
基金项目:Supported by National Natural Science Foundation of China(No.60272009)and National 863 Plan Project(NO.2001AA1230131)
摘    要:A closed form expression for the bit error rate (BER) performance of frequency domaindifferential demodulation(FDDD) for orthogonal frequency division multiplexing system in flat fadingchannel is derived.The performance is evaluated by computer simulation and compared with the timedomain differential demodulation(TDDD).The results indicate that the performance of FDDD is betterthan that of TDDD,and the lower band of BER in the former is lower than that of the latter.
